A seasonally-inspired interactive entertainment activity challenges participants to solve puzzles and riddles within a defined time limit, all while immersed in a festive, spooky atmosphere. For instance, participants might find themselves locked inside a simulated haunted mansion, requiring them to decipher clues hidden amongst cobwebs and eerie decorations to achieve freedom.
The allure of such activities lies in their capacity to foster teamwork, problem-solving skills, and creative thinking. Moreover, they offer an engaging and memorable experience that transcends typical holiday celebrations, providing an avenue for immersive entertainment that encourages active participation. 2. Puzzle Integration
Puzzle integration is paramount to the success of a seasonally-themed interactive entertainment, determining the coherence and engagement levels within the experience. The puzzles must not only be challenging and stimulating, but also logically consistent with the environment and narrative established.
-
Thematic Relevance
Puzzles should align seamlessly with the season and any established narrative. For example, a riddle involving identifying ingredients for a witch’s brew would be thematically appropriate, whereas a complex math problem would disrupt the immersive experience. Puzzle design should reflect the established setting and tone.
-
Difficulty Calibration
The complexity of puzzles must be carefully calibrated to the intended audience. Overly simple puzzles may bore experienced participants, while excessively difficult challenges can frustrate newcomers and detract from the enjoyment. Difficulty should escalate gradually and incorporate a range of problem-solving skills.
-
Mechanical Integration
Puzzles should often trigger physical or mechanical elements within the environment, enhancing the tactile and visual experience. A solved riddle might unlock a hidden compartment, reveal a secret passage, or activate a special effect. The integration of mechanical elements promotes a sense of discovery and reinforces the connection between problem-solving and tangible results.
-
Narrative Progression
Each solved puzzle should contribute meaningfully to the advancement of the narrative, revealing new clues, unlocking new areas, or bringing participants closer to their stated objective. Avoid puzzles that feel arbitrary or disconnected from the overall storyline. Integrate puzzles as integral steps in the unfolding narrative.
The successful implementation of interactive seasonal entertainment activities necessitates the thoughtful creation and integration of puzzles. When designed with thematic relevance, difficulty calibration, mechanical integration, and narrative progression in mind, puzzles can transform a simple activity into a captivating and engaging experience, drawing participants further into the seasonally-themed world.

4. Atmospheric Design
Atmospheric design is foundational to the success of seasonally-themed interactive entertainment, specifically a Halloween-themed escape room. It directly influences participant immersion and emotional engagement. The deliberate manipulation of sensory stimulilighting, sound, scent, and tactile elementsestablishes a convincing environment. Dim lighting, for example, generates suspense and obscures details, encouraging exploration. Simultaneously, strategically placed sound effects, such as creaking floors or distant whispers, amplify the feeling of unease or dread. These components collectively contribute to a heightened sense of realism, intensifying the entertainment experience.
Consider the practical application of this understanding. A dimly lit room, adorned with cobwebs and aged props, creates an immediate sense of abandonment. Soundtracks featuring minor keys and dissonant chords establish a disquieting background ambiance. The introduction of scents, such as decaying leaves or musty odors, further enhances the sense of immersion. In contrast, bright, sterile lighting or upbeat music would immediately undermine the established atmosphere, reducing participant engagement. Careful coordination of these elements dictates the effectiveness of the designed environment. Real-world examples can include escape rooms designed to emulate classic horror settings, such as a haunted mansion or a derelict laboratory, which capitalize on these atmospheric cues to maximize the entertainment value.

5. Technical Elements
Technical elements represent critical infrastructure supporting interactive entertainment experiences, directly influencing functionality, immersion, and overall enjoyment. In the context of seasonally-themed interactive entertainment, appropriate technological integration amplifies the effect of atmospheric design and puzzle mechanics.
-
Automated Puzzle Mechanisms
The integration of automated mechanisms elevates puzzle design beyond conventional locks and keys. Solved puzzles can trigger electronic devices, activate moving components, or unveil hidden compartments. Examples include pressure-sensitive platforms that initiate light sequences, infrared sensors that detect specific object arrangements, or voice-activated mechanisms that respond to spoken phrases. These components enhance the tactile and visual engagement, reinforcing the sense of discovery and interaction within the activity.
-
Sound and Lighting Control Systems
Sophisticated control systems manage complex sound and lighting schemes, enabling dynamic and adaptive environmental cues. Soundscapes can shift in response to player actions, creating a sense of mounting tension or signaling successful puzzle completion. Intelligent lighting systems can alter brightness, color, and patterns, highlighting key elements or casting eerie shadows. Automated sound and lighting are essential components that dynamically contribute to narrative immersion and enhance the seasonal environment.
-
Sensor Integration and Tracking
The incorporation of sensors and tracking technology enables more personalized and interactive experiences. Motion sensors can detect player movement, triggering events or dynamically altering the environment. Radio-frequency identification (RFID) tags can track object placement, enabling puzzles that require specific arrangements. Tracking technology enhances the level of interaction and adaptability, allowing for more sophisticated game mechanics and adaptive difficulty levels.
-
Safety and Monitoring Systems
Safety mechanisms form an integral part of interactive entertainment, ensuring the well-being of participants. Surveillance cameras, emergency stop buttons, and communication systems enable constant monitoring and prompt intervention in unforeseen circumstances. Properly integrated safety features minimize risks and maintain a secure environment, permitting participants to fully engage without compromising personal safety.
These facets of technological integration substantially enhance the entertainment value and complexity of seasonally themed, interactive entertainment activities. By incorporating automated mechanisms, advanced control systems, tracking technology, and safety measures, designers can create immersive and engaging activities that exceed conventional entertainment formats.

7. Safety Protocols
Interactive entertainment formats, particularly a seasonally themed escape room, necessitate strict adherence to established safety protocols. The immersive nature of these environments, often involving simulated hazards and restricted spaces, introduces potential risks that demand careful mitigation. A failure to implement adequate safety measures can result in physical injury, psychological distress, or even legal liabilities. Examples include inadequate emergency exits, improperly secured props, or insufficient ventilation, all posing significant dangers to participants. Thus, stringent protocols become an inextricable component of the entertainment experience.
Effective safety protocols encompass a comprehensive range of measures, spanning design, implementation, and operational phases. Pre-activity briefings informing participants of potential risks, emergency procedures, and safe interaction guidelines form a crucial foundation. Regular inspection and maintenance of the physical environment and technical equipment ensure operational integrity and prevent malfunctions. Trained personnel, equipped to manage emergencies and provide assistance, must be present during all activities. A real-world case involved an entertainment establishment experiencing a fire during an activity, where pre-established evacuation procedures and readily available safety equipment proved instrumental in ensuring the safe removal of all participants. This underscores the practical significance of robust planning and execution.

8. Time Constraints
Time constraints represent a fundamental design element within seasonal, interactive entertainment formats. The imposed limitation contributes significantly to the overall intensity and engagement of the activity, particularly within a Halloween-themed escape room. The fixed timeframe acts as a catalyst, intensifying pressure on participants and driving the need for rapid problem-solving. A Halloween-themed scenario, combined with a ticking clock, amplifies the sense of urgency. The limited duration intrinsically increases the challenge presented by the puzzles and tasks. The absence of a time limit diminishes the sense of consequence, potentially transforming the experience from a thrilling challenge into a leisurely exercise. The implementation of a fixed duration ensures that the participants must actively engage in the solution of puzzles; real-world examples, like a 60-minute duration on the activity ensures that participants will maximize all their brain power. Participants may, therefore, optimize critical-thinking skills.
Further analysis shows that the judicious application of time constraints allows the operators of seasonal entertainment formats to effectively control the pacing and difficulty of the activity. A shorter timeframe inherently increases the difficulty, necessitating a more streamlined puzzle design and efficient collaborative efforts. Conversely, an extended duration allows for the incorporation of more complex or multifaceted puzzles, accommodating a broader range of skill levels. Careful calibration of the time constraint based on the complexity of the design, the difficulty of the puzzles, and the expected skill level of the participants is essential for optimizing engagement and ensuring a rewarding experience. Practical considerations might dictate shortening the duration if the complexity of the puzzles is reduced, ensuring that time pressure continues to drive engagement.

Tips for Creating a Compelling Halloween Themed Escape Room
The creation of a successful interactive seasonal entertainment experience hinges on thoughtful planning and meticulous execution. The following tips offer guidance for designing an engaging and immersive experience.
Tip 1: Establish a Strong Narrative Foundation: A compelling narrative provides context for the challenges and enhances participant engagement. A coherent storyline, aligned with the Halloween theme, provides motivation and contributes to a sense of purpose. For example, a narrative centered around escaping a haunted mansion or preventing a malevolent ritual would provide a strong framework.
Tip 2: Prioritize Thematic Consistency: Maintain thematic consistency across all elements of the escape room. Visual design, sound design, puzzle design, and narrative integration must reinforce the Halloween theme. Inconsistencies detract from the immersive experience. Cobwebs, eerie lighting, and unsettling sound effects contribute to an authentic atmosphere.
Tip 3: Calibrate Puzzle Difficulty Appropriately: Puzzle difficulty should be carefully calibrated to the target audience. Overly simple puzzles may bore experienced participants, while excessively challenging puzzles can frustrate newcomers. A balance between accessibility and complexity is essential. Incorporate a mix of puzzle types to engage diverse skill sets.
Tip 4: Integrate Technology Strategically: Utilize technology to enhance the immersive experience. Automated puzzle mechanisms, dynamic lighting systems, and interactive soundscapes can elevate the sense of realism. However, avoid technology for its own sake; ensure that it contributes meaningfully to the narrative and puzzle design.
Tip 5: Emphasize Collaboration: Design puzzles that necessitate collaboration among participants. A collaborative approach encourages communication, problem-solving, and shared engagement. Structure puzzles to require diverse skill sets, ensuring that each participant can contribute meaningfully to the solution.
Tip 6: Implement Rigorous Safety Protocols: Prioritize participant safety above all else. Ensure clear emergency exits, secure props, adequate ventilation, and trained personnel. Pre-activity briefings should inform participants of potential risks and emergency procedures. Safety measures are non-negotiable.
Tip 7: Optimize Time Constraints: Calibrate the time constraint based on the complexity of the puzzles and the expected skill level of participants. A thoughtfully designed time limit intensifies the experience and promotes rapid problem-solving. Overly generous or overly restrictive time limits diminish the overall impact.
